Sergei Trofimov
c82dd87830 Adding cpuidle modules and refactoring Device cpufreq APIs.
cpuidle module implements cpuidle state discovery, query and
manipulation for a Linux device. This replaces the more primitive
get_cpuidle_states method of LinuxDevice.

Renamed APIs (and added a couple of new ones) to be more consistent:

"core" APIs take a core name as the parameter (e.g. "a15") or whatever
is listed in core_names for that device.
"cluster" APIs take a numeric cluster ID (eg. 0) as the parameter. These
get mapped using core_clusters for that device.
"cpu" APIs take a cpufreq cpu ID as a parameter. These could be
integers, e.g. 0, or full string id, e.g. "cpu0".

Kevin Hilman
bf12d18457 common/linux/device.py: don't require sudo if already root user
On generic_linux devices, one might ssh as the root user, in which
case there is no need to use sudo.

In addition, some root filesystems may not have sudo (e.g. minimal
buildroot/busybox).

This patch attempts to detect the root user using 'id -u' and, if it
detects the root user, avoids the use of sudo for running commands as
well.
